The charity supports other defined groups. The Institute Of Automotive Engineer Assessors is a registered charity whose purpose is education and training. It delivers its work by acting as an umbrella or resource body. The charity is based in Milton Keynes and operates in England And Wales, Ireland, and various other locations.

Activities & Mission

To promote and develop for the public benefit the science of the design, manufacture and related technology of motor vehicles and the science of their repair; and to further public education therein.
